FRAM, o Ferroelectric Ram, es el nuevo método de almacenamiento de datos más cool del que hablan todas las revistas de moda.
Oh, espera, no, eso son bolsos acolchados. Pero el FRAM también está muy bien. Es similar a la memoria dinámica de acceso aleatorio, sólo que con una capa ferroeléctrica en lugar de una capa dieléctrica. Esto le da un manejo estable (los bytes que escribes son no volátiles) con una capacidad de respuesta dinámica (¡puedes escribirlos muy rápido!)Ahora, con esta placa breakout SPI FRAM puedes añadir algo de almacenamiento FRAM a tu próximo proyecto DIY. La FRAM permite un menor consumo de energía y un mayor rendimiento de escritura. Es excelente para el registro de datos de baja potencia o de potencia inconsistente o para el almacenamiento de datos en el que se desea transmitir datos rápidamente mientras se mantienen los datos cuando no hay energía. A diferencia de Flash o EEPROM, no hay páginas de las que preocuparse. Cada byte se puede leer/escribir 10.000.000.000 de veces, por lo que no hay que preocuparse demasiado por la nivelación del desgaste.Este chip FRAM en particular tiene 2 Megabits (256 KBytes) de almacenamiento, interfaces que utilizan SPI, y puede funcionar a velocidades de reloj de hasta 40 MHz. Cada byte puede leerse y escribirse instantáneamente (como la SRAM) pero mantendrá la memoria durante 95 años a temperatura ambiente. Adafruit puso esta práctica maravilla magnética en una placa breakout con cambio de nivel lógico de 3,3V y regulador para que tou pueda usar este chip con alimentación y lógica de 3V o 5V. Se presenta en un breakout apto para la placa de circuito impreso y un trozo de cabecera estándar de 0,1".
¿Busca algo con más bytes? Mira el breakout de 4 MBit / 512 KBytes. Además, también disponemos de una placa breakout I²C FRAM, de mayor tamaño pero más lenta (velocidad máxima de reloj I²C de 1MHz).
Consulta esta guía de uso de FRAM para ver los esquemas, diagramas, hojas de datos y código de ejemplo para Arduino y CircuitPython y Python.
DETALLES TÉCNICOS
Consulta esta guía de uso de la FRAM para obtener esquemas, diagramas, hojas de datos y código de ejemplo para Arduino y CircuitPython y Python.
Configuración de bits: 262.144 palabras x 8 bits
Interfaz de periféricos en serie: SPI (Serial Peripheral Interface)
Corresponde al modo SPI 0 (0, 0) y al modo 3 (1, 1)
Frecuencia de funcionamiento: 40MHz Max
Alta resistencia: 10^13 veces / byte - ¡eso es 10.000.000.000 de veces!
Conservación de datos: 10 años (a +85 °C), 95 años (a +55 °C), o más de 200 años (a +35 °C)
Bajo consumo de energía: Corriente de alimentación de funcionamiento 2,6mA (Max @ 40 MHz)
Rango de temperatura ambiente de funcionamiento : -40 °C a +85 °C